A company wants to fill a Chief Information Security Officer position. Which of the following qualifications and experience would be MOST desirable in a candidate?
A.
Multiple certifications, strong technical capabilities and lengthy resume
B.
Industry certifications, technical knowledge and program management skills
C.
College degree, audit capabilities and complex project management
D.
Multiple references, strong background check and industry certifications
A Chief Information Security Officer (CISO) role requires a balanced skill set that includes industry-recognized certifications (e.g., CISSP, CISM) for credibility, technical knowledge to understand and mitigate risks, and program management skills to oversee security strategies and initiatives. While references, background checks, and audit capabilities are valuable, the combination in B reflects the most desirable qualifications for leading organizational security.
